	 <t>This document defines a new Outbound Router Filter (ORF) type for BGP, termed &quot;Address Prefix Outbound Route Filter&quot;, that can be used to perform address-prefix-based route filtering.  This ORF-type supports prefix-length- or range-based matching, wild-card-based address prefix matching, as well as the exact address prefix matching for address families. [STANDARDS-TRACK]
